Method of monitoring gas turbine engine operation

Abstract
A system, method and apparatus for monitoring the performance of a gas turbine engine. A counter value Indicative of the comparison between the engine condition and the threshold condition is adjusted. The aircraft operator is warned of an impending maintenance condition based on the counter value and determines an appropriate course of action.

15. A method of monitoring the performance of an aircraft-mounted gas turbine engine, the method comprising the steps of:
-
sensing effect of at least one ambient weather condition on at least one engine operating parameter;
comparing the sensed effect against a predetermined threshold condition, wherein the threshold condition is different from an engine-at-limit condition such that when the threshold condition is met continued engine operation is still permitted within a selected operational margin prior to a next related maintenance operation;
warning an operator of the aircraft when the predetermined threshold condition Is met; and
thenselecting at least one of a maintenance task and an operating plan for the aircraft based at least partially on expected ambient conditions at an intended destination to thereby operate the aircraft within the operational margin. - View Dependent Claims (16, 17, 18, 19)

20. A method of extending operation of an aircraft-mounted gas turbine engine, the method comprising the steps of:
-
monitoring a temperature of the engine;
counting at least occurrences of a threshold temperature exceedance and occurrences of a threshold temperature non-exceedance;
when a predetermined count value is achieved, selecting an aircraft flight plan to provide a cool operating environment which thereby extends permissible operation period of the engine before a next engine maintenance event is required. - View Dependent Claims (21, 22)

23. A system for monitoring the performance of an aircraft-mounted gas turbine engine, the system comprising:
-
a sensor to monitor an engine parameter and detect a difference in the engine parameter between an actual value and an expected value;
a counter to keep track of a counter value based on engine parameter actual- expected difference sensed;
a comparator to compare the counter value to a warn point corresponding to an at- limit point corresponding to the engine parameter, where the warn point is different than the at-limit point and to set a warning flag indicative of an impending maintenance condition when the counter value meets at least a first criterion based on said comparison; and
an indicator to advise an operator of the aircraft that the warning flag has been set.
